I am using a width of 4 khz and using the radio in split mode.
Width of 4 KHz is useless with a 2800 Hz SSB filter.  You do not
need (and can't use) more than 3000 - 3300 Hz.

The default shift of 1500 (for DATA A) will provide relatively
flat audio response from 300 Hz to 2800 Hz with Width at 3000 Hz.
If you move the shift to 1700 the "flat area" of the audio pass-
band will be about 300 to 3000 Hz.

Remember, with a 2800 Hz filter the maximum bandwidth is 2800 Hz
between the -3 dB points.  Setting a wider DSP filter is not going
to make the flat are any wider it will only allow you to see more
of the filter skirts.  If you really need the full 4 KHz get an
AM (6 KHz) or FM (13 KHz) filter.

Hope this is not a dupe.  I sent it over an hour ago and nothing showed up.

I am trying to tweak my WSJTX setup.  What is the recommended shift for the
K3S while running WSJTX?  I have the 2.8 khz SSB filter installed.  I am
using a width of 4 khz and using the radio in split mode.
